MAAS, #1 New York Times Bestselling Author Seventeen-year-old Kiva Meridan has spent the last ten years fighting for survival in the notorious death prison, Zalindov, working as the prison healer. When the Rebel Queen is captured, Kiva is charged with keeping the terminally ill woman alive long enough for her to undergo the Trial by Ordeal: a series of elemental challenges against the torments of air, fire, water, and earth, assigned to only the most dangerous of criminals. Then a coded message from Kiva's family arrives, containing a single order- "Don't let her die. We are coming." Aware that the Trials will kill the sickly queen, Kiva risks her own life to volunteer in her place. If she succeeds, both she and the queen will be granted their freedom. But no one has ever survived. With an incurable plague sweeping Zalindov, a mysterious new inmate fighting for Kiva's heart, and a prison rebellion brewing, Kiva can't escape the terrible feeling that her trials have only just begun. The Prison Healer

The Prison Healer by Lynette Noni is a phenomenal book with a creative and suspenseful plot. Noni is an incredibly skilled writer who easily captures the attention of the reader and uses specific but thought-provoking details that allow one to envision the compelling setting of the prison. Her unique writing style differs from other fantasy authors, and it makes this dark book series even more special. Furthermore, this dynamic story describes seventeen year old Kiva, who is attempting to survive the difficult conditions of Zalindov prison and helps others as the prison healer. When the Rebel Queen is captured, Kiva must keep her alive long enough to face the Trial of Ordeal, and she allies with others to accomplish her goal. In addition, Kiva knows that the Rebel Queen will not survive the trials and volunteers to take her place in hopes that they will eventually both be freed. Adding to the dangers, Kiva faces an incurable plague spreading throughout the area and a chaotic prison rebellion. This plot-driven story fills the reader with different emotions like sorrow and fear, which makes the storyline very interesting. Although there were some gruesome events in the story, there were also several surprising and unpredictable twists and turns. The story included moments of romance as well, which enhanced the plot without overshadowing it. My favorite character, Kiva, is strong and independent with a desire to heal and assist many people, even those who do not necessarily deserve it. I admire her courage because despite being so young, she was forced to witness many horrible events and endure terrible grief. I also enjoyed learning about Kiva’s relationships with a young boy named Tipp, a considerate guard, and a mysterious inmate. It was fascinating to see her grow mentally throughout the book and slowly open up to those around her as she developed connections with the other characters. In fact, the personalities of characters like Jarren, Tipp, and Naari each served a different purpose and added to the uniqueness of the story. Furthermore, the book explores important ideas of survival, loyalty, and the harsh realities of prison life. Noni’s usage of vocabulary leaves an extremely powerful effect on the reader and shares valuable messages. One of my favorite quotes by Noni in the book, which deeply resembles those ideas, was “Our scars define us. They tell us a story of courage and survival. They tell of who we are at our deepest being, of the challenges we’ve faced and overcome.” This quote refers to how Kiva’s survival in the cruel prison of Zalidov has changed her identity and is a reminder of her strength. It emphasizes how the experiences and challenges we face shape our character, which readers like me can apply to our own lives. Also, I was very intrigued by the cliffhanger at the end of the book, and I am eager to read more of Lynette Noni’s works in the future. I strongly recommend that you begin reading this entertaining book series.
